Kait graduated from Oakland University in 2023 with an MA in Clinical Mental Health Counseling, and from Western Michigan University in 2019 with a BS in Psychology and Gender and Women's Studies.
She has always been passionate about LGBTQ+ issues, having written undergraduate honors thesis on the safety of LGBTQ+ students on Western Michigan University's campus, and so that has easily transitioned into a professional life as a mental health counselor serving the LGBTQ+ population. Kait also enjoys working with adolescents (12+), young adults, and adults who experience struggles associated with depression and anxiety, OCD, disordered eating and body image, life transitions, and identity exploration.
Kait tends to draw from an eclectic mix of evidence-based approaches, including a Person-Centered Therapy,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Narrative Therapy, Feminist and Multicultural Therapy, Motivational Interviewing, and Mindfulness. Kait plans to learn more about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) and Exposure and Response Prevention (ERP) to widen my scope.
